This free SSH testing tool checks the configuration of given server accessible over internet. We don't ask you for any login or password, this service only returns information available during SSH handshake - notably supported encryption and MAC algorithms, and an overview of offered server public keys.

Under 1KB each! Super Tiny Web Icons are minuscule SVG versions of your favourite logos. The average size is under 465 bytes!
The logos have a 512x512 viewbox, they will fit in a circle with radius 256. They will scale up and down to suit your needs.

Joplin is a free, open source note taking and to-do application, which can handle a large number of notes organised into notebooks. The notes are searchable, can be copied, tagged and modified either from the applications directly or from your own text editor. The notes are in Markdown format.
Notes exported from Evernote via .enex files can be imported into Joplin, including the formatted content (which is converted to Markdown), resources (images, attachments, etc.) and complete metadata (geolocation, updated time, created time, etc.).
The notes can be synchronised with various targets including Nextcloud, the file system (for example with a network directory) or with Microsoft OneDrive. When synchronising the notes, notebooks, tags and other metadata are saved to plain text files which can be easily inspected, backed up and moved around.
The UI of the terminal client is built on top of the great terminal-kit library, the desktop client using Electron, and the Android client front end is done using React Native.

Hacker101 is structured as a set of video lessons – some covering multiple topics, some covering a single one – and can be consumed in two different ways. You can either watch them in the order produced as in a normal class (§ Sessions), or you can watch individual videos (§ Vulnerabilities). If you’re new to security, we recommend the former; this provides a guided path through the content and covers more than just individual bugs.
Additionally, there are coursework levels where you can hunt for bugs and experiment with exploitation in practice. As you work through the content, try out the coursework to see what you can find!
Query your devices like a database
Osquery uses basic SQL commands to leverage a relational data-model to describe a device.

Do you get most of your news from social media? Us too. Do you know anything about how they pick what to show you? No? Neither do we. Facebook, Twitter, and others sites use complicated computerized rules to decide which posts you see at the top of your feed and which you don't. These algorithms have reinforced our echo chamber - showing us content like what we share - and made hard to burst our filter bubbles - hiding content that is different than what we believe. We think escaping these echo chambers and seeing a wider picture of the news is a critical piece of democratic society. We built Gobo to help demonstrate, and think about, how to do that.

A webform, web form or HTML form on a web page allows a user to enter data that is sent to a server for processing. Forms can resemble paper or database forms because web users fill out the forms using checkboxes, radio buttons, or text fields. For example, forms can be used to enter shipping or credit card data to order a product, or can be used to retrieve search results from a search engine.
